WebThe following fruits below may be high in water content but they are not included as part of the fluid allowance: Apples (84%) Blackberries (88.2%) Blueberries (85%) Cherries (84%) Cranberries (87%) Grapes (82%) … WebEating the right foods—and avoiding foods high in sodium, potassium, and phosphorus —may prevent or delay some health problems from CKD. What you eat and drink may also affect how well your kidney disease treatments work. Understanding how calories, fats, protein, and liquids affect the body is important for people with advanced CKD. WebMar 22, 2024 · Oranges are also high in potassium. One orange contains around 255 mg of potassium 19 and one cup of orange juice contains 443 mg. 20.
